Alan Cox wrote:
>> Concerning the crashes I already changed the memory module, but with no 
>> success. I'm not sure
>> wether this is a hardware or software bug.
>>     
>
> Testing with memtest86 should help tell you if the problem is a dodgy
> DIMM specifically rather than another hardware or software fault.
>   

I already did this. I had a broken aeneon DIMM at first. I got a new 
working one.
But the crashes were still there. Then I got a samsung DIMM instead and 
it did
not get better. Therefore I think that the memory is not causing this.

Actually the system freezes when I click somewhere with my USB mouse, even
with no load at all. Unfortunately the system does not have a serial 
port for
a serial console. Netconsole was not working with the via-rhine. I wanted to
try serial console over ttyUSB, but I did not have time for it, yet.
